## Vendored Fonts

Welcome aboard! A quick note on fonts: the Typeglen rendering API won't fetch fonts from the public internet, so everything gets vendored into the `assets/fonts` bundle at build time via the Fontsmith packager. Don't hand-copy font files — the packager handles licensing checks and subsetting for you. To pull the approved font manifest, you'll call the internal Fontsmith registry, which requires authentication. Use the registry key that appears right below this paragraph when configuring your local environment.

gateway credential: kto11_pTkcHgLwuNE

Leadership Review Briefing — Loyalty Programme Overhaul
For the Board of Larchmont Retail Group.

The proposed overhaul replaces the points-per-purchase scheme with tiered benefits under the working name Evergreen Circle. Pilot data from the Northvale region shows improved repeat-visit rates but higher redemption costs than modelled. We recommend a phased rollout with quarterly cost gates and a revised breakage assumption. The confidential note appended below details the underlying commercial plan.

confidential, kajof-tahof: The pricing group signed off on a budget of $491.8 million for Project Casvan.

**Q: How does Fleetwren pick a driver for a new job?**

A: It scores nearby drivers on distance, current load, and streak bonus, then assigns the top score unless the driver declined a similar job in the last hour. Don't override scores manually. The scoring weights and edge cases are documented on this page:

runbook for hawif-tajeg: https://grafana.plorvasoft.example/dash

## Authentication

Heads up, reviewer: the Perchstand kiosk watchdog phones home to our Owlery health service every 30 seconds, and yes, it authenticates on every ping — we tried session tokens but kiosks reboot too often for that to be worth it. Auth is a single static key passed in a header; rotation happens quarterly via the fleet config push. For local testing against staging, use the key below.

service key, fawip-bajef: kto11_Qt5wZK9vdNC